I want to escape my desk after work. which is the best handheld for FFXIV? by Riou_Atreides in ffxiv

[–]EmptyForms 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I play primarily with my Odin 2 mini. The screen is small for the game, but there’s lots of options for scaling the UI so it plays perfectly fine for me. Having the touch screen helps a lot sometimes. One of the larger Odin devices would probably handle it a little better, but all in all the game has been a great experience handheld. I stream it via Steam Link.
